Intel to pay AMD $1.25 billion to settle IP disputes.

Nokia files IP infringement suit against Apple for infringing Nokia’s 10 wireless patents.

Anglo-Swedish drug giant sues one of the India’s top pharma company for infringing the innovator’s patent coverage by attempting to manufacture and market anti-ulcer drug.

One of the top French drug maker asks a U.S. federal court to block another drug manufacturer from selling a generic version of its cancer drug in the United States because it infringes its patent.

An Indian drug manufacturer announces acquisition of a patent – its shares surge more that 4% on Indian bourses.

Protecting your IP is Important

Monetizing: Market capitalization of Eli Lilly decreased by $36 million – a loss of 1/3 market cap,

after the US Court of Appeals’ decided that Eli Lilly’s patent on Prozac was invalid (August 09, 2000).

Royalties from inventions were estimated at $150 billion/year worldwide (in 2002) and were expected to grow at 30% p.a. for the subsequent 5 years.

Infringement: Fonar, a small medical firm with annual revenues of less than $12 million, gained $128.7

million as damages from GE for infringement on Fonar’s MRI patent. J&J was awarded $324 million in a stent patent infringement case against Boston

Scientific. Medical Instrument was awarded $424 million in a patent lawsuit against Elekta in the

year 2002. Monsanto agreed to pay $100 million to University of California for somatostatin for

exclusive rights to market the animal growth hormone.

CADTRAK: Set up in 1980 to manufacture workstations One patent:

A means of improving graphics processing Uses selective erase technology to improve graphic response time Patented technology used in EGA/VGA specifications

What did CADTRAK do? It licensed out its patent to 400 companies, including IBM

Commodore Corp – infringed, rejected licensing offer, was sued and went bankrupt

Summary 5 people, 2 computers, 1 patent = USD 50 million !!

IP Protection – it could be a BIG Business Opportunity
